This PR fixes an unbounded growth path in the Pellworth image cache: evicted entries retained decoded bitmaps via a listener reference. From a security standpoint, the leak allowed memory exhaustion under adversarial thumbnail requests. Eviction is now deterministic and bounded. The cache limits applied after this change are:

constants for tageg-kagag:
QUOTAS = {
    "kelax": 495,
    "istath": 366,
    "tammir": 108,
    "novdor": 730,
    "casax": 816,
    "quenael": 874,
    "pelius": 403,
}

Runbook: GiftLeaf Receipt Mailer. The mailer batches donation receipts nightly at 02:00 and sends via the Brindlemail relay. Templates are signed at build time; the worker refuses unsigned templates and logs a SIGFAIL event. PII in the queue is encrypted at rest and purged 72 hours after successful delivery. Retries cap at three before the batch is parked for manual review. Delivery stats, bounce rates, and the signing audit trail are published on the internal status page.

runbook for badug-kadup: https://confluence.zemvarlabs.internal/projects/browse/display/projects/bd1b

Hi Mara,

Quick handover: the full set of master keys for the Larkspur annex is in the grey lockbox, tagged and counted — eleven keys total. Courier from Quillan Express brings it over Tuesday morning. Sign nothing until you've checked the tag. For the actual hand-over, do exactly what's written below.

drop instructions, yafog-yawip: the quenmir olidor courier leaves the julox tamion keliel ledger at gate 5283 under passcode 336825

## DeployDot Bot v3.1 — Key Rotation

We have rotated the signing key used to verify third-party plugin payloads for DeployDot, the deploy-status chat bot. The previous key is revoked effective this release; plugins signed with it will be rejected at load time. Please re-sign and republish your plugins promptly. For verification during re-signing, the new public key is provided below.

rollout seal: bky9_PeXH1fTLY